HomeSort by relevance Sort by last modified time
    Searched refs:CodeGenRegBank (Results 1 - 11 of 11) sorted by null

  /external/swiftshader/third_party/LLVM/utils/TableGen/
RegisterInfoEmitter.h 24 class CodeGenRegBank;
34 void runEnums(raw_ostream &o, CodeGenTarget &Target, CodeGenRegBank &Bank);
37 void runMCDesc(raw_ostream &o, CodeGenTarget &Target, CodeGenRegBank &Bank);
41 CodeGenRegBank &Bank);
45 CodeGenRegBank &Bank);
CodeGenRegisters.h 32 class CodeGenRegBank;
49 const SubRegMap &getSubRegs(CodeGenRegBank&);
102 void inheritProperties(CodeGenRegBank&);
186 CodeGenRegisterClass(CodeGenRegBank&, Record *R);
216 // Called by CodeGenRegBank::CodeGenRegBank().
217 static void computeSubClasses(CodeGenRegBank&);
220 // CodeGenRegBank - Represent a target's registers and the relations between
222 class CodeGenRegBank {
252 CodeGenRegBank(RecordKeeper&)
    [all...]
CodeGenRegisters.cpp 49 CodeGenRegister::getSubRegs(CodeGenRegBank &RegBank) {
258 CodeGenRegisterClass::CodeGenRegisterClass(CodeGenRegBank &RegBank, Record *R)
351 void CodeGenRegisterClass::inheritProperties(CodeGenRegBank &RegBank) {
463 void CodeGenRegisterClass::computeSubClasses(CodeGenRegBank &RegBank) {
508 // CodeGenRegBank
511 CodeGenRegBank::CodeGenRegBank(RecordKeeper &Records) : Records(Records) {
564 CodeGenRegister *CodeGenRegBank::getReg(Record *Def) {
573 void CodeGenRegBank::addToMaps(CodeGenRegisterClass *RC) {
585 CodeGenRegisterClass *CodeGenRegBank::getRegClass(Record *Def)
    [all...]
CodeGenTarget.h 68 mutable CodeGenRegBank *RegBank;
99 CodeGenRegBank &getRegBank() const;
RegisterInfoEmitter.cpp 31 CodeGenTarget &Target, CodeGenRegBank &Bank) {
243 CodeGenRegBank &RegBank) {
407 CodeGenRegBank &RegBank) {
483 CodeGenRegBank &RegBank){
842 CodeGenRegBank &RegBank = Target.getRegBank();
CodeGenTarget.cpp 161 CodeGenRegBank &CodeGenTarget::getRegBank() const {
163 RegBank = new CodeGenRegBank(Records);
  /external/llvm/utils/TableGen/
CodeGenRegisters.h 35 class CodeGenRegBank;
108 void updateComponents(CodeGenRegBank&);
143 void buildObjectGraph(CodeGenRegBank&);
147 const SubRegMap &computeSubRegs(CodeGenRegBank&);
150 void computeSecondarySubRegs(CodeGenRegBank&);
154 void computeSuperRegs(CodeGenRegBank&);
163 CodeGenRegBank&) const;
224 bool inheritRegUnits(CodeGenRegBank &RegBank);
231 unsigned getWeight(const CodeGenRegBank &RegBank) const;
280 void inheritProperties(CodeGenRegBank&)
    [all...]
CodeGenRegisters.cpp 56 void CodeGenSubRegIndex::updateComponents(CodeGenRegBank &RegBank) {
117 void CodeGenRegister::buildObjectGraph(CodeGenRegBank &RegBank) {
202 bool CodeGenRegister::inheritRegUnits(CodeGenRegBank &RegBank) {
215 CodeGenRegister::computeSubRegs(CodeGenRegBank &RegBank) {
410 void CodeGenRegister::computeSecondarySubRegs(CodeGenRegBank &RegBank) {
478 void CodeGenRegister::computeSuperRegs(CodeGenRegBank &RegBank) {
510 CodeGenRegBank &RegBank) const {
524 unsigned CodeGenRegister::getWeight(const CodeGenRegBank &RegBank) const {
653 CodeGenRegisterClass::CodeGenRegisterClass(CodeGenRegBank &RegBank, Record *R)
722 CodeGenRegisterClass::CodeGenRegisterClass(CodeGenRegBank &RegBank
    [all...]
CodeGenTarget.h 70 mutable std::unique_ptr<CodeGenRegBank> RegBank;
114 CodeGenRegBank &getRegBank() const;
RegisterInfoEmitter.cpp 55 void runEnums(raw_ostream &o, CodeGenTarget &Target, CodeGenRegBank &Bank);
58 void runMCDesc(raw_ostream &o, CodeGenTarget &Target, CodeGenRegBank &Bank);
62 CodeGenRegBank &Bank);
66 CodeGenRegBank &Bank);
77 void EmitRegUnitPressure(raw_ostream &OS, const CodeGenRegBank &RegBank,
79 void emitComposeSubRegIndices(raw_ostream &OS, CodeGenRegBank &RegBank,
81 void emitComposeSubRegIndexLaneMask(raw_ostream &OS, CodeGenRegBank &RegBank,
89 CodeGenTarget &Target, CodeGenRegBank &Bank) {
190 EmitRegUnitPressure(raw_ostream &OS, const CodeGenRegBank &RegBank,
648 CodeGenRegBank &RegBank
    [all...]
CodeGenTarget.cpp 221 CodeGenRegBank &CodeGenTarget::getRegBank() const {
223 RegBank = llvm::make_unique<CodeGenRegBank>(Records);

Completed in 455 milliseconds